2. Mastering Bitcoin by Andreas Antonopoulos
Mastering Bitcoin by Andreas Antonopoulos is a totally free book (PDF, EPUB, MOBI) about Bitcoin published in 2014.
The course discusses the technical ideas behind Bitcoin and how they are executed, and how to use the Bitcoin software application to produce new deals and engage with existing ones. Tony Robbins Summit.
This course isn’t an extensive reference work on Bitcoin. Rather, it’s for non-technical readers who want to comprehend the core principles of this new technology and its implementation however do not want to become developers or compile source code.
Mastering Bitcoin offers an extensive insight into Bitcoin for non-technical readers and technical information for advanced readers. The course remains in three main parts:
• The first part covers the technical structures of bitcoin, its procedures, and its applications. It describes the bitcoin procedure in detail and explains how cryptography is used to protect transactions using sophisticated mathematics and theory.
• The 2nd part describes various applications for bitcoin users, such as wallets and mining. It likewise describes how to utilize bitcoin to develop brand-new financial applications. It covers subjects such as security measures, developing tools for designers, and applications for non-technical users such as merchants and exchanges.
• The third part describes the future of bitcoin, including possible scenarios for regulators, financial institutions, and technology suppliers such as Google or Amazon.

5. Mastering Ethereum: Building Smart Contracts and DApps by Andreas Antonopoulos
This crypto course will teach you how to develop clever agreements and decentralized applications (DApps) on the Ethereum blockchain. You will establish your own cryptographically safe and secure digital identity and check out how to utilize it to communicate with DApps. You will also find out about Ethereum’s virtual maker, the most powerful computing engine around, and establish a decentralized application that operates on this machine.
Mastering Ethereum covers:
• How Ethereum works.
• Ethereum’s role in cryptography.
• How cryptocurrency works.
• Technical information of deals and wise agreements.
• The role of mining in a Blockchain platform like Ethereum.
• Proof-of-work algorithm (PoW).
• Future developments in Ethereum such as Casper, Sharding, and Plasma.
